Chimney cap installation services involve fitting a protective cover at the top of a chimney to prevent debris, animals, and water from entering the flue. The process typically includes assessing the chimney’s dimensions, selecting an appropriate cap material, and securely installing the cap to ensure it stays in place. Proper installation helps maintain the chimney’s functionality while safeguarding the interior of the property from potential damage caused by external elements or pests.

One of the primary issues addressed by chimney cap services is water intrusion. Without a cap, rainwater can seep into the chimney, leading to rust, deterioration of the masonry, and potential leaks inside the property. Additionally, chimney caps help prevent animals like birds, squirrels, or raccoons from nesting inside, which can block airflow and cause smoke or carbon monoxide to back up into the living space. They also act as a barrier against falling debris, such as leaves or branches, that could obstruct the flue or pose fire hazards.

Properties that commonly utilize chimney cap installation include residential homes with fireplaces or wood stoves, especially those in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high wildlife activity. Commercial buildings with venting systems or industrial chimneys may also require specialized caps to ensure proper venting and protection. Whether a property is a single-family residence, multi-unit dwelling, or commercial establishment, a properly installed chimney cap can help preserve the integrity of the chimney system and reduce maintenance needs over time.

Cost Range for Chimney Cap Installation - The typical cost for installing a chimney cap varies between $150 and $400, depending on the chimney size and material. Larger or custom caps may increase the price beyond this range. Local service providers can offer specific estimates based on the chimney's details.

Factors Influencing Costs - Costs can fluctuate based on the type of chimney cap chosen, such as stainless steel or copper, with prices ranging from $100 to $300 for materials alone. Additional labor fees may apply, making total expenses vary accordingly. Contact local pros for precise quotes.

Average Cost Components - The installation service typically costs between $100 and $250, with some providers including removal of old caps or additional repairs in the estimate. Material costs are generally separate but can be included in the overall price. Local contractors can provide tailored pricing based on project specifics.

Cost Variations by Location - Prices for chimney cap installation in Bergenfield, NJ, and nearby areas generally fall within $150 to $400. Regional labor rates and material availability can influence the final cost. Getting multiple estimates from local pros is recommended for accurate budgeting.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a chimney cap? A chimney cap is a protective cover installed at the top of a chimney to prevent debris, animals, and rain from entering the flue.

Why should I install a chimney cap? Installing a chimney cap helps protect the chimney from damage, reduces the risk of pests, and prevents water from causing deterioration.

What types of chimney caps are available? There are various options including mesh caps, rain caps, and decorative caps, each offering different levels of protection and aesthetic appeal.

How long does chimney cap installation typically take? The installation process usually takes a few hours, depending on the chimney's height and type.
